How to fill out the IL Cook County Pension Fund Consent To Issuance Of QILDRO online

Completing the IL Cook County Pension Fund Consent To Issuance Of QILDRO is an essential step for members seeking to authorize specific distributions of their pension benefits.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to assist users in filling out the form accurately and efficiently online.

Follow the steps to complete the consent form online

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the form and open it in your browser's editor.
  2. In the caption section, enter the judicial district and county of the issuing court, ensuring that it is an Illinois court.
  3. Provide the case caption and the case number in the designated fields.
  4. In the body of the form, fill in the required information: the member's name, their social security number, the alternate payee’s name, and the alternate payee's social security number.
  5. Ensure the member's consent statement is correctly filled, indicating their understanding of the irrevocability of the consent and the implications for their benefits.
  6. Date the form and include the member's signature in the designated area to validate the consent.
  7. After completing the form, check for any missing information or errors, and make necessary corrections.
  8. Save the original form, as only the original consent will be valid. You can then print or share the completed form as needed.

The biggest difference between a QDRO and a QILDRO is that while a QDRO can assign survivor benefits, a QILDRO terminates on the participant's death and the former spouse only receives benefits when they are paid to the participant.

By law, you contribute 8.5% (Sheriff Police 9%) of your salary to the Cook County Pension Fund (CCPF). Your contributions are allocated to support your retirement annuity, your surviving spouse annuity (spouse annuity) and your Cost of Living Adjustments (COLA).

The QILDRO Calculation Court Order is a separate court order issued by an Illinois court. This order provides numerical information as determined in the divorce proceedings to instruct MEABF how much to pay the alternate payee.

Additional Information. When an employee or retired employee dies, the CCPF provides a $1,000.00 Death Benefit, payable to the beneficiaries designated on record with CCPF. Retirees are entitled to a pension payment for the month in which they were alive.
